    So, where does the iPad Mini 2 fit in? Let's get to the main point – the iPad Mini 2 cannot be officially upgraded to iOS 15. The last supported iOS version for this model is iOS 12.     Why the iPad Mini 2 Can't Run iOS 15

    Okay, so the iPad Mini 2 is stuck on iOS 12. But why? Let's get into the nitty-gritty of the technical limitations. As mentioned earlier, the older hardware plays a massive role. The processor in the iPad Mini 2, the Apple A7 chip, is simply not powerful enough to run iOS 15 effectively.

    • Processor Limitations: iOS 15 requires a more powerful processor to handle its features. The A7 chip is significantly older, and the new iOS would likely result in sluggish performance, frequent crashes, and a generally frustrating user experience. It's like trying to run a race in boots! The processor is the brain of the device, and if the brain is too old, it can't handle the new workload.
    • RAM Constraints: The iPad Mini 2 has a limited amount of RAM. iOS 15 demands more RAM to handle multitasking and run apps efficiently. With the limited RAM, the iPad Mini 2 would struggle to manage the processes, leading to slower app loading times and reduced responsiveness.     The Implications of Not Upgrading

    Okay, so your iPad Mini 2 is stuck on iOS 12. What does this mean for you, the user? Let's look at the real-world implications of not being able to update to iOS 15, and the challenges you might face.

    • Security Risks: This is a big one, guys. Older iOS versions become more vulnerable to security threats. As time goes on, hackers discover new ways to exploit vulnerabilities. Apple releases security patches with each new iOS update to fix these holes. If you're not updating, you're not getting these patches. This puts your data at risk, from your personal information to your accounts and financial details. It's like leaving your door unlocked in a high-crime area. Not good!
    • App Compatibility Issues: New apps and app updates are often designed to work with the latest iOS versions. So, you might find that some newer apps simply won't install or won't work correctly on your iPad Mini 2. You may see error messages or experience a lack of functionality.
